  • homepage  About us  History

    1960

    Founding Of Shanghai TV University (SHTVU) and offering of undergraduate education for adults.

    1966

    Suspension Of Shanghai TV University (SHTVU)

    1978

    Resumption of SHTVU and offering of junior college education for adults.

    1996

    Offering Of undergraduate education for junior college graduates with the support of CRTVU Programs.

    1997

    Setting-up of the UNESCO Chair on UNITWIN Network in Distance and Open Learning.

    1998

    Independent offering of junior college distance education program for registered students.

    2003

    Student enrollment amounting to 100,000, and the university being a mega-university in the world.

    2005

    Achieving “Excellent” in the summative assessment of the, “CRTVU Project of Talent Training Mode Reform and Open Education Experimentation” organized by the Ministry Of Education of China.

    2008

    Taking the initiative to apply for and passing the Education Quality Audit of the International Council of Distance Education (ICDE).

    2010

    Establishing Shanghai Open University based on Shanghai TV University with the approval of Shanghai Municipal People’s Government.Constructing Shanghai Open University on the list of “Outline of Shanghai Municipal Plan for Medium and Long-term Education Reform and Development (2010-2020)” issued by Shanghai Municipal People’s Government.“Exploring a Model Of Open University Construction” as a key project of the national education system reform.

    2011

    “The Ordinance for the Promotion of Life-long Education in Shanghai” stating that open universities established in Shanghai should gradually integrate adult higher education resources to form open learning platforms.Participating the ’20+20 Cooperation Plan for Chinese and African Institutions of Higher Education’, a plan cooperated by UNESCO and the Ministry Of education; carrying out strategic cooperation with the African Council Of Distance Education (ACDE).

    2012

    Renaming Shanghai TV University as Shanghai Open University with the approval of the Ministry of Education of China

    2014

    Added as a bachelor’s degree granting unit by Shanghai Academic Degrees Committee
